All channels open to Christchurch

The announcement by the New Zealand Prime Minister regarding an early opening of the New Zealand border to Australians is a great boost for Comms Connect NZ, allowing the June event to feature live presentations from industry leaders from both sides of the Tasman; as well as the promise of more delegates, sponsors and exhibitors.

An added bonus for Kiwis and Aussies alike is the NZ Matariki public holiday on 24 June, providing an opportunity to add on some long-awaited rest and recreation time in the snowfields to the south, or the vineyards to the north of Christchurch.
